Top Searches for this datasheetAME1117 AME1117 low-dropout positive voltage regulator. available fixed adjustable output voltage versions. Overcurrent thermal protection integrated onto chip. Output current will limit while reaches pre-set current temperature limit. dropout voltage specified 1.4V Maximum full rated output current. AME1117 series provides excellent regulation over line, load temperature variations. Current Limit Protection AME1117 protected against overload conditions. Current protection triggered typically 1.5A. Stability Load Regulation AME1117 requires capacitor from VOUT provide compensation feedback internal gain stage. This ensure stability output terminal. Typically, 10µF tantalum 50µF aluminum electrolytic sufficient. (Note: important that this capacitor does exceed 0.5.) However, device functionality only guaranteed maximum junction temperature +125oC. power dissipation junction temperature AME1117 given (VIN VOUT) IOUT TJUNCTION TAMBIENT Note: JUNCTION must exceed 125oC Connect load Rev.S.02 AME1117 Thermal Consideration AME1117 series contain thermal limiting circuitry designed protect itself from over-temperature conditions. Even normal load conditions, maximum junction temperature ratings must exceeded. mentioned thermal protection section, need consider sources thermal resistance between junction ambient. includes junction-to-case, case-to-heat-sink interface heat sink thermal resistance itself. Junction-to-case thermal resistance specified from junction bottom case directly below die. Proper mounting required ensure best possible thermal flow from this area package heat sink. case devices this product series electrically connected output. Therefore, case device must electrically isolated, thermally conductive spacer recommended. Dropout Positive Voltage Regulator Rev.S.02 AME1117 Advanced Applications (contd.)
